Grammar Rules
Command verb
وَءَاتُوا۟ (And give) is a command — it's telling someone to do something.
We translate it as a direct command — "[Do this]!"
Verb form IV — causative
وَءَاتُوا۟ (And give) uses form IV (أَفْعَلَ) — the أ at the start makes it causative ("to make someone do something").
We translate it as "to make [someone] do" or "to cause [action]".
Conjunction وَ (and)
وَءَاتُوا۟ (And give) starts with وَ, the most common Arabic word — it means "and".
We add "and" to connect this to what came before.
Sahih International
And give to the orphans their properties and do not substitute the defective [of your own] for the good [of theirs]. And do not consume their properties into your own. Indeed, that is ever a great sin.
